I have received the very same email several times throughout the years. Always  forward the email to:  spoof@paypal.com and you will be notified within minutes by paypal.  It has always been a scam.  Never, ever give out any information (even if it is information that paypal already has and they are asking you to confirm it for whatever reason they may give you).  Follow your gut / instincts if something seems off.  Better safe than sorry.
